Abstract

An infrared detector assembly is disclosed which includes a photosensitive layer (111) and a first planar contact structure (113) conductively coupled to the photosensitive layer for collecting charge carriers generated by radiation incident on the photosensitive layer. The detector assembly further includes a second planar contact structure (119) substantially coextensive with and separated from the first planar contact structure. A dielectric layer (115) separates the first and second planar contact structures. The first and second planar contact structures and the dielectric structure form a feedback capacitor which is integral with the detector assembly and which provides feedback capacitance for an externally provided amplifier.
